Job Description Summary
The Ambulatory Float RN will possess the ability to assess, plan, implement, evaluate and accurately document nursing care in four procedural and ambulatory areas including Endoscopy, Outpatient Infusion, Pain Management and Interventional Radiology/Nephrology. Coordinates all aspects of nursing care with all disciplines to achieve defined patient outcomes. Demonstrates initiative, knowledge and clinical skills in caring for the patient with complex needs. Needs to possess the skill to provide appropriate education to the patient and family regarding their plan of care. The Ambulatory Float RN must demonstrate excellent customer service skills when interacting with patients, families and coworkers.

  • Bachelor's Degree Nursing required

  • MA Registered Nurse License required

  • BLS and ACLS required

  • Previous procedural/ ambulatory nursing experience preferred

Brigham and Women's Faulkner Hospital is a non-profit, community teaching hospital located in Jamaica Plain directly across the street from the Arnold Arboretum. Founded in 1900, Brigham and Women's Faulkner Hospital offers comprehensive care in a wide variety of specialties. Brigham and Women's Faulkner Hospital is a designated Magnet hospital by the American Nurses Credentialing Center, a recognition that fewer than nine percent of all US hospitals receive.
